Abstract
A composite frozen confection containing a layer of ice confection and a layer or coating of fat based confectionery having suspended therein flavoring and sweetening solids wherein the fat composition has a SCI of: PA1 70-93 at -20.degree. C. PA1 60-93 at -10.degree. C. PA1 55-90 at 0.degree. C. PA1 15-40 at 20.degree. C. PA1 0-12 at 30.degree. C. PA1 0 at 40.degree. C. A slip melting point in the range of 25.degree.-45.degree. C., and a coating pliability parameter of at least 3. The frozen confection may also include a dry confection such as a wafer wherein the fat based confection separates the ice confection from such dry confection.
